JamboMc Posted November 17, 2011 Share Posted November 17, 2011 18:10 17/11/2011 MOSCOW, November 17 (RIA Novosti) ? Hearts owner Vladimir Romanov confirmed to RIA Novosti on Thursday that he is selling the club and quitting football entirely, ending weeks of speculation on the future of the Tynecastle club. The Russian-born Lithuanian said he has begun the hunt for potential buyers of the Scottish Premier League side, who are thought to be 35 million pounds in debt. ?I want to leave football. I have given the order to find buyers for all my clubs,? Romanov told RIA Novosti. Romanov has had a stormy tenure since arriving in Edinburgh in 2005, earning a hire-them-and-fire-them reputation for going through eight managers in six years. ?I want to buy a theater and sell the clubs,? he said. ?Hearts is controlled by Murdoch?s media mafia,? he said in reference to Rupert Murdoch, the owner of News Corp., which controls Sky television, the sport?s top broadcast rights holder.
